titleOfInvention | Preparation method of tributylphosphane |
abstract | The invention relates to a preparation method of tributylphosphane. The preparation method comprises the following steps: (1) adding N-butene and an initiator in a nitrogen replacement raw material mixed kettle, and stirring so as to obtain a mixture, adding the mixture in a nitrogen replacement reaction system, raising the temperature to 80 DEG C, simultaneously adding phosphine gas, controlling the reaction temperature to 80-85 DGE C and controlling the reaction pressure to 5.0-8.0 Mpa, continuing to carry out heat and pressure preservation reaction for 2 hours after adding materials and phosphine, reducing the temperature to less than 50 DEG C, and depressurizing the reaction system to 0.5Mpa; and (2) replacing a rectification system with nitrogen, adding a reaction liquid to a rectification tower, regulating vacuum degree to 200mbar, raising the temperature to 80 DEG C, collecting light components, improving the vacuum degree to 5mbar, raising the temperature to 150 DEG C, and then collecting fraction. The preparation method is simple, cost is low, and yield is larger than 93.5%; the preparation method is suitable for industrial production; and reaction is carried out by adopting high pressure under which butane and phosphine are liquid, so that the reaction is easy to carry out. |
